我正在调试报表创建器的使用。我忘了一行,并且想编辑代码而不触发构建管道。

我知道可以在提交管道中编写[ci skip]来传递Jenkins CI中的管道执行,但是我使用的是GitLab CI。

GitLab CI是否存在相同的机制?我在文档中找不到它。

评论

docs.gitlab.com/ee/ci/yaml/#skipping-jobs

#1 楼

是的,有:


如果您的提交消息包含[ci skip][skip ci],则使用任何大写字母将创建该提交,但将跳过管道。

另外,如果使用Git 2.10或更高版本,则可以传递ci.skip Git推送选项:

git push -o ci.skip



来自:GitLab CI YAML文档-“跳过作业”

评论


看一下push命令选项的完整列表

–Felipe Alvarez
19/12/12在5:26